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Cantley to Raynes Park start from as little as £14.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Cantley to Raynes Park start from £75.10 one way, or £76.10 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Cantley to Raynes Park are available for £111.30 one way, or £161.10 return

Facilities at Cantley Train Station

Despite lacking a formal ticket office, Cantley station is well-equipped with ticket machines that cater to both regular and accessible customers. You can effortlessly collect your tickets bought online at these machines. Additionally, the station is fitted with an induction loop for the hearing impaired, making it more inclusive for travelers with specific needs.

Although there are no waiting rooms or lounges at Cantley, there is available seating. The station's step-free access is rated as category B1, ensuring relatively easy mobility for individuals with physical challenges. When assistance is needed, help points and a customer service helpline are available to support travelers from 8 AM to 8 PM, Monday through Sunday.

Facilities and Amenities

When it comes to ticketing, Raynes Park station is well-prepared. The ticket office is open from early morning until late in the evening, giving you ample time to purchase your travel tickets. There are also ticket machines available for your convenience. Plus, if you prefer buying your tickets online, you can conveniently collect them from the machines at the station.

Raynes Park is partially accessible, with step-free access to platforms 1 and 2 for trains heading towards London Waterloo, though platforms 3 and 4 require navigating steep ramps. It's important to note there is an induction loop available, and ticket machines are accessible, including those that offer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

While waiting for your train, you can make use of the seating areas and the heated waiting room located on platforms 3 and 4. For a quick refreshment or leisurely coffee, there are cafes conveniently located near the entrances of platforms 1/2 and 3/4. Additionally, a Starbucks can be found near the entrance of these platforms.
